Output 63d86866ae8ca822f99e276d85251a883102716a7616bab5c274584221626aaa: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da7eb0a0bdedec9f6e9b70bfc23791549ed0ab42 OP_EQUALVERIFY OP_CHECKSIG
address
1LvJ5PhDmhs3PJLLhyzWJCwTcUytNrtt26
transaction
63d86866ae8ca822f99e276d85251a883102716a7616bab5c274584221626aaa
spent
true